Transaction 329c80187b5df15721f42afac28e2180a08863e6673938cef5bca7cfdb10ef52

2 Input
2 Outputs
  • 329c80187b5df15721f42afac28e2180a08863e6673938cef5bca7cfdb10ef52:0
  • value  67364047
    address  1566vR3VDvAevrBgXGNgZ4kPu74qbJDAFX
  • 329c80187b5df15721f42afac28e2180a08863e6673938cef5bca7cfdb10ef52:1
  • value  37313
    address  1LvkBzomvgPnJKsPapWn3EMRFynjeZapJR